Elena Alexandra Apostoleanu (born October 16, 1986), professionally known as Inna (styled as INNA), is a Romanian singer, dancer and philanthropist. She rose to major fame in 2009, when her debut studio album Hot was an international success, appearing in many record charts around the world and reaching the top-ten in Czech Republic, France and the United Kingdom. The album's lead single of the same name charted worldwide, topping the US Hot Dance Airplay in 2009.

Reaching the top twenty across multiple charts, it achieved commercial success worldwide. "Hot" was certified Gold in Italy, Silver in the United Kingdom, and Platinum in Spain. During 2009 and early 2010, she released four more singles from her debut studio album, Hot, which sold one million copies worldwide. One of these singles was "Amazing", which reached the number-one position on the Romanian Top 100, while "10 Minutes" marked the fourth time that Inna reached the top ten in France. Her second studio album, I Am the Club Rocker, was released in 2011. For this album, Inna collaborated with Flo Rida and Juan Magan on "Club Rocker" and "Un Momento", respectively. The lead single, "Sun Is Up", was certified Gold in Italy and Switzerland and was the 17th best-selling single of 2011 in France, with it bringing sales of over 100,000 registered copies there.
In March 2013, Inna made her third studio album, Party Never Ends, available for purchase. "Tu şi eu", the Romanian-language version of "Crazy Sexy Wild", peaked at number five in Romania. "More than Friends", a collaboration with Daddy Yankee, peaked at number seven in Spain, where it was certified Gold for being streamed four million times.[3] The album's opener, "In Your Eyes", reached number 44 in Romania. Following this, Inna released her self-titled fourth studio album and its Japanese version, Body and the Sun, in 2015. The first single off the Japanese release, "Cola Song", features J Balvin on guest vocals. The track became commercially successful in Europe, eventually reaching number eight on the Spanish Singles Chart. In early 2015, it was certified Platinum in Spain. "Diggy Down", the first release off Inna, scored Inna's second number one song in her native Romania.
